    Default C550 and Java

    I am trying to tranfer Java application from PC to my new C550,
    unsuccessfully!
    No problem transferring others files such as sounds, pictures, contacts,
    sms.

    Of course I have already activated the Java transfer using PST.

    I tried with many applications (Midway, Mobile Phone Tools, PST, PK2)

    Hey,

    If u are trying to upload games onto ur c550, u need to make sure u have activated 'java app loader' which u can do w/ 'motorola service software' which i downloaded from http://www.motclub.com/. install the program and click on activate java app loader, reset ur phone and u'll find the option under 'java settings' in ur main menu

    then, on ur phone, click on 'java app loader', connect ur phone w/ ur usb cable, then open 'midway'. change the settings to suit ur setup, for example, my phone connects through COM port 3, then open up ur .jad files and upload ur games.
